2015-02-13 10:27 GMT+01:00 Stefano Dal Pra <s.dal...@gmail.com>:

>
>
>
> On Fri, Feb 13, 2015 at 10:15 AM, Marco Beri <marcob...@gmail.com> wrote:
>
>> 2015-02-13 9:50 GMT+01:00 Diego Barrera <diegonebarr...@yahoo.it>:
>>
>>> |print  sum([xfor  xin  xrange(3,1000,3)if  not  x %3  or  not  x %5])|
>>
>>
>> Ahia.... ecco... sei giĆ  drogato :-)
>>
>> Lancio una sfida qui: chi riesce a risolvere il numero 16 in meno
>> caratteri?
>>
>> https://projecteuler.net/problem=16
>>
>> Ciao.
>> Marco.
>>
>
> Io dico 33
> >>> sum(int(c) for c in "%d"%2**1000)
> 1366
>
> >>> 'sum(int(c) for c in "%d"%2**1000)'.__len__()
> 33
>
>  Stefano
>
> Rilancio con 28:

>>> sum(map(int,"%d"%(2**1000)))
1366
>>> 'sum(map(int,"%d"%(2**1000)))'.__len__()
28



>
>> --
>> http://beri.it/ - Un blog
>> http://beri.it/i-miei-libri/ - Qualche libro
>> http://beri.it/articoli/ - Qualche articolo
>>
>> _______________________________________________
>> Python mailing list
>> Python@lists.python.it
>> http://lists.python.it/mailman/listinfo/python
>>
>>
>
_______________________________________________
Python mailing list
Python@lists.python.it
http://lists.python.it/mailman/listinfo/python

Rispondere a